    This!!! 567 312-155 2R sized to .310” for the trusty old .308!!! I’m trying to load a photo but no go from my phone anyway Powder coated in Smokes blue and some white mixed in, baked at 425f for one hour, into a bucket of Ice water! Sages gas checks and here we go! Long day!!

    Finally got to shoot my 30-30 after 3 months of ownership! It was an Accurate 31-157R sized .312, lubed with Carnuba Blue, over 7 grains of Red Dot. Was very accurate at 30-40 yards, about an inch Standing unsupported. However, it shot 9 inches low. Moved the rear sight elevator to its top position and still 5 inches low. Skinner sight will be on order.

Abbreviations used in Reloading

BP Bronze Point IMR Improved Military Rifle PTD Pointed
BR Bench Rest M Magnum RN Round Nose
BT Boat Tail PL Power-Lokt SP Soft Point
C Compressed Charge PR Primer SPCL Soft Point "Core-Lokt"
HP Hollow Point PSPCL Pointed Soft Point "Core Lokt" C.O.L. Cartridge Overall Length
PSP Pointed Soft Point Spz Spitzer Point SBT Spitzer Boat Tail
LRN Lead Round Nose LWC Lead Wad Cutter LSWC Lead Semi Wad Cutter
GC Gas Check
